Vision
Escalating virtualisation licensing costs, an ageing on-premises estate, and the looming expense of a hardware refresh prompted the Group to reconsider the foundations of its infrastructure. Recent changes to its incumbent virtualisation platform's licensing model had materially increased ongoing costs, while a sprawling virtual server estate had grown inefficient and difficult to protect. The organisation operated a hybrid, multi-site environment spanning corporate systems and specialised operational technology, which added complexity to any change.
estrat was engaged to assess the environment, prove the business case for change, and chart a pragmatic path forward. The review confirmed that migrating from VMware to Microsoft Hyper-V — a hypervisor already covered by the Group's existing Microsoft agreements — would remove a significant and rising cost, while a parallel rationalisation of the estate and a modern disaster recovery capability would reduce both risk and complexity. A clear, costed roadmap gave leadership the confidence to proceed.
Traction
With the business case approved, estrat led the end-to-end delivery: planning, project management, and the hands-on technical migration. Workloads were moved in carefully sequenced waves through a disciplined change process, with each machine validated before its predecessor was retired. Critical systems — including the Group's ERP and data warehouse — were transitioned with minimal disruption to daily operations, and a concurrent network upgrade improved connectivity while reducing carriage costs.
Alongside the migration, estrat rationalised the estate, decommissioning redundant and dormant servers to reduce the footprint by roughly 40 per cent. A multi-cloud disaster recovery solution was established using Azure Site Recovery, replicating production workloads to the cloud with recovery points measured in minutes. Backup integrity was verified across platforms, and failover testing confirmed the environment could be recovered with confidence. Even ageing and operational-technology systems across multiple sites were brought across successfully. estrat also managed the exit from a legacy data centre, coordinating the network changes and the orderly removal of redundant infrastructure.
Results
The Group now runs a leaner, modern virtualisation platform, having removed a significant and rising licensing cost by adopting a hypervisor already licensed within its Microsoft agreements. The estate is simpler to manage and protect, and for the first time enjoys tested, cloud-based disaster recovery with rapid recovery objectives.
Consolidating onto a single, well-understood platform has improved reliability and freed the internal team to focus on higher-value work. Ongoing workload optimisation — right-sizing resources and eliminating waste — continues to keep running costs under control, and the retirement of a legacy data centre has removed a further layer of cost and risk.
Delivered through close collaboration between the Group's IT team and estrat, the project has positioned the organisation for its next step: a planned migration of production workloads into the public cloud, again avoiding costly on-premises investment. This diversified Western Australian group operates across manufacturing, construction and industrial sectors, supported by a hybrid, multi-site IT environment. Facing rising virtualisation licensing costs and an ageing infrastructure estate, it engaged estrat to modernise its platform. estrat planned and proved the business case, migrated the environment from VMware to Microsoft Hyper-V, rationalised the server fleet, established cloud-based disaster recovery, and continues to optimise workloads for cost and resilience.
